The Biden administration has reached a preliminary agreement with Micron, a semiconductor manufacturer based in Idaho, to invest $6.1 billion in the construction of two manufacturing hubs. One of the hubs will be located in Clay, New York, near Syracuse, while the other will be built in Boise, Idaho. President Biden is expected to visit Syracuse on Thursday to highlight the benefits of this agreement and showcase Micron’s achievements.
The investment is part of the bipartisan CHIPS and Science Act and is seen as a significant step towards strengthening the semiconductor industry in the United States and ensuring its competitiveness in the global market.
